Product details
Overview
SN74AUP1G07DRYR from Texas Instruments is a single non-inverting buffer with open-drain output, designed for ultra-low-power logic translation and level-shifting in battery-powered systems. It operates across 0.8 V to 3.6 V supply, delivers 3.3 ns max propagation delay at 3.3 V, supports Ioff for live insertion, and features 1.5 pF typical input capacitance - enabling use in portable medical sensors and optical networking interfaces.
For engineers reviewing the SN74AUP1G07DRYR datasheet, SN74AUP1G07DRYR pinout, SN74AUP1G07DRYR application, or SN74AUP1G07DRYR equivalent, key selection criteria include its 0.9 µA max ICC quiescent current, 3.6-V I/O tolerance, input hysteresis (250 mV typ), open-drain drive capability up to 20 mA, and SON-6 package compatibility with high-density PCB layouts.
Technical Context
The SN74AUP1G07DRYR implements a CMOS-based single-buffer architecture with an open-drain output stage, requiring an external pull-up resistor to define logic-high voltage. Its Ioff circuitry actively disables outputs when VCC = 0 V, preventing back-drive current during partial power-down - critical for hot-swap and mixed-voltage system interconnects.
Input hysteresis (250 mV typ at 3.3 V) improves noise immunity against slow-rising signals and EMI in noisy environments, while low dynamic power (Cpd = 1 pF typ at 3.3 V) and sub-1 µA static current enable multi-year operation in energy-constrained applications like wearable biometrics and field transmitters.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| VCC Range | 0.8 V to 3.6 V - enables direct interface between 0.8-V microcontrollers and 3.3-V peripherals without external level shifters. |
| tpd Max | 3.3 ns at 3.3 V, CL = 5 pF - supports >100 MHz signal routing in timing-critical point-to-point links. |
| ICC Max | 0.9 µA at 3.6 V - reduces standby power in always-on sensor nodes and IoT edge devices. |
| Ioff | 0.6 µA max at 0 V VCC - ensures safe live insertion and prevents damage during board hot-plug operations. |
| Input Hysteresis | 250 mV typical at 3.3 V - rejects ±100 mV of switching noise on slow-transition inputs (e.g., mechanical switch debouncing). |
| IO Max | 20 mA sink per output - drives standard LED indicators, I²C bus lines, or small MOSFET gates directly. |
| Ci | 1.5 pF typical - minimizes capacitive loading on high-impedance source signals such as piezoelectric sensors. |
Pinout & Package
SN74AUP1G07DRYR uses a 6-pin SON (Small Outline No-Lead) package measuring 1.45 mm × 1.00 mm with 0.5-mm pitch, optimized for space-constrained portable designs. Thermal resistance RθJA is 554.9°C/W, requiring careful thermal layout in continuous-current applications.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| No Connection (N.C.) | Internally unconnected; must be left floating or tied to GND per layout best practice - no electrical function. |
| 2 | Input A | CMOS-compatible digital input with hysteresis; accepts 0–3.6 V regardless of VCC, enabling down-translation. |
| 3 | GND | Primary ground reference for logic and power domains; requires low-inductance connection to PCB ground plane. |
| 4 | Output Y | Open-drain NMOS output - must be pulled up externally; sinks up to 20 mA; supports wired-AND bus topologies. |
| 5 | VCC | Core supply pin; bypass with 0.1 µF capacitor placed within 2 mm to minimize switching noise and supply droop. |
| 6 | No Connection (N.C.) | Internally unconnected; electrically isolated - no routing or soldering required. |
Key Features
| Feature | Design Value |
|---|---|
| Ultra-low ICC | 0.9 µA max at 3.6 V - extends battery life in coin-cell-powered devices beyond 5 years in sleep mode. |
| Ioff Support | Active protection at VCC = 0 V - eliminates risk of back-current damage during hot-swap or power sequencing faults. |
| 3.6-V I/O Tolerance | Input/output pins tolerate up to 3.6 V independent of VCC - simplifies mixed-voltage interfacing without discrete clamps. |
| Input Hysteresis | 250 mV typical at 3.3 V - eliminates false triggering from EMI or slow RC-filtered signals in industrial sensor nodes. |
| Open-Drain Output | Configurable logic-high via external pull-up - enables shared-bus communication (e.g., I²C, SMBus) and active-low wired-OR functions. |

Equivalent & Alternatives
The following parts are listed as comparable options for similar buffer/level-shifter applications.
| Alternative Part | Technical Difference | Application Difference | Selection Advice |
|---|---|---|---|
| SN74LVC1G07DRYR | Higher ICC (10 µA typ), wider VCC range (1.65–5.5 V), no Ioff support | Suitable for 5-V tolerant industrial I/O but lacks live-insertion safety for hot-swap modules | Choose when 5-V compatibility is mandatory and partial-power-down is not required. |
| NC7SZ07P5X | Smaller SOT-353 (5-pin) package, 1.65–5.5 V operation, 3.5 ns tpd, no hysteresis | Better for cost-sensitive consumer electronics; lacks noise immunity for medical-grade sensor paths | Prefer where board space is tighter than noise margin, and ESD robustness (2-kV HBM) suffices. |
Compared with SN74LVC1G07DRYR and NC7SZ07P5X, SN74AUP1G07DRYR uniquely combines sub-1-µA quiescent current, Ioff-enabled hot-swap safety, and input hysteresis - making it the only choice for FDA-cleared portable diagnostics and battery-operated field instruments demanding >10-year shelf life.

FAQ
What is the maximum sink current supported by SN74AUP1G07DRYR?
SN74AUP1G07DRYR supports a maximum output sink current of 20 mA per output, as specified under Recommended Operating Conditions. This rating applies across the full 0.8 V to 3.6 V VCC range and ensures reliable drive of LEDs, small MOSFET gates, or I²C bus lines without external amplification. Exceeding this limit risks parametric shift or accelerated wear-out.
Does SN74AUP1G07DRYR support live insertion or hot-swap applications?
Yes, SN74AUP1G07DRYR includes Ioff circuitry that disables outputs when VCC = 0 V, preventing damaging back-current flow during live insertion. This feature is validated per JESD78 Class II latch-up testing and allows safe board replacement in powered-backplane systems - a key requirement in modular medical equipment and ATCA telecom platforms.
Can SN74AUP1G07DRYR translate between 0.8-V and 3.3-V logic domains?
Yes, SN74AUP1G07DRYR supports true bidirectional voltage translation: its inputs tolerate up to 3.6 V regardless of VCC, and its open-drain output can be pulled up to any voltage ≤3.6 V. When VCC = 0.8 V and the pull-up is at 3.3 V, SN74AUP1G07DRYR reliably converts 0.8-V MCU outputs to 3.3-V peripheral inputs without additional components.
What is the purpose of the two N.C. pins on SN74AUP1G07DRYR?
SN74AUP1G07DRYR has two No-Connection (N.C.) pins - Pin 1 and Pin 6 - which are internally unconnected and serve no electrical function. They may be left floating or tied to GND for mechanical stability; neither connection affects device operation. These pins exist due to package footprint standardization across TI's 6-pin SON logic portfolio.
How does input hysteresis improve noise immunity in SN74AUP1G07DRYR?
SN74AUP1G07DRYR provides 250 mV typical input hysteresis at 3.3 V, meaning the VIH threshold is ~250 mV higher than the VIL threshold. This gap prevents oscillation on slow-rising or noisy signals - such as those from thermistors, mechanical switches, or long cables - ensuring clean, glitch-free transitions into downstream logic or ADC sampling circuits.
